Mining Community

• Used to be a tight group of people

• Early developers were the first miners

• Then less pure math, but programmers came along

• Introduced GPU mining, FPGA mining, ASIC (Application-

specific Integrated circuit)

• Very good concurrent programming skills required

• You could run it on your own computer (GPU, radeon,

preferably)

• The amount of ASICs have too much mining power, mining on

CPU, GPU and FPGA is no longer feasible

• Difficulty too high

• Bitcoin enthousiasts still do it, just because it’s fun to be part of

the ”banking world” and having everybodies transaction go

through your pc!

Grey side of BitCoin

• Money transfers between countries (tor to hide ip and nobody will be

any wiser)

• Avoid transaction fees (send money overseas)

• Use it as savings account (no taxes!)

• Pay for ”under the counter”, but legal goods/services

• ”Legal” companies/governments just simply don’t like it

• MasterCard is trying to impose fees on every bitcoin transaction

• China increases taxes when using BitCoins (but doesn’t mind the huge server

farms in the country)

• TOR for ip + Bitcoin laundrying (tumbling) = very secretive transfers

• Tumblers:

• Bitcoins are not traceable! Transactions are!

• Send from A to B through tumbler: tumbler receives big amounts of

transactions, splits them into several smaller transactions, adds time delay

etc, making it very hard to track where your original bitcoin went to after the

tumbler.

Dark side of Bitcoin – Silk Road

• Biggest (ex)market for all kinds of illegal goods

• Fake IDs

• Narcotics

• Services (hitmarkets, smuggling, ...)

• Run by ”Dread Pirate Roberts”, see next slides

• Part of ”deep web”, only found through usage of TOR

• 175 000 bitcoins were seized

• 30 000 were sold to Tim Draper (17 000 000 $)

• 144 000 are still in FBI hands ...

• Silk road 2.0

• 6.11.2013 online by old admins

• 5.11.2014 ”Defcon” arrested by operation Onymous and site offline

again

• Rumours about Silk road 3.0 ...

Dread Pirate Robers (The 1st!)

• Name gets passed every time to operator of Silk Road, First

DPR was longest in business and gathered quite a lot of wealth

• Operators of Silk Road were paid by DPR, average 1000-2000$

per week ...

• 8-15% of all sales went to Silk Road (DPR) as commission

• FBI caught him! But how?

• Ross Ulbricht

• Arrested by FBI in science fiction section of the

San Fransisco public library

• His story is just as crazy as the average science

fiction book found in there.

• FBI agents waited until he entered his passwords on his computer

before arresting him

• Go back to basics!

• Feds traced back all the way to the very first mentioning of Silk

Road, under normal circumstances this is somebody involved.

Dread Pirate Robers (The 1st!) - continued

• Handle ”altoid” posted on forum about magic mushrooms that

he wanted to buy off silk road

• Altoid later posted on bitcoin forum similar post about silk road

• Altoid later (8 months) posted that he was looking for ”IT pro in

BTC community” ....

• Altoid asked people to redirect queries to

[email protected] (not the smartest move perhaps)

• Looking at the gmail account and sending subpoena to Google

revealed a g+ account with youtube

• Both youtube account and DPR has been posting very similar

videos about liberal ideas and free market values

• Story becomes vague at this point

• FBI suddenly intercepted a ton of fake IDs at the border with

Ulbricht’s picture on it

• DPR posted on silk road’s forum that he needed fake IDs for new

website rental

Dread Pirate Robers (The 1st!) - continued

• The end of DPR story? Not quite!

• How about adding 2 murder attemps?

• One admin had gotten arrested through dealing with undercover agent

and his account had been confiscated

• DPR was furious about this and realised the issue this might bring for the

website

• He ordered a person to kill the admin (FriendlyChemist)

• The person he ordered the ”hit” from ... Was the very same undercover agent

that arrested FriendlyChemist in the first place

• FBI faked torture pictures and death pictures and send them to Ulbricht, who

paid 2x 40 000$ for the ”kill”.

• Another person had tried to blackmail DPR and he wanted money to

pay off his own drug dealers, DPR got in contact with the ”drug dealers”

and ordered another hit on the blackmailer

• He paid 150 000$ for it (he was confused why he had to pay so much!)

• The person that was supposed to be killed was never reported dead and

person doesn’t seem to exist, location of the murder also never showed any

murders happening there.

Dread Pirate Robers (The 1st!) - continued

• Site was actually found by small security hole in it and running a service that

bypassed TOR

• Site provider was subpoenad and copy of server was sent to FBI

• Based on copy they found code that Robert Ulbricht had inquired about on

stackoverflow (using his real name again...)

• He changed the name and email on stackoverflow to frosty

• Site was signed with sshkey: frosty@frosty

• Trial for Ross Ulbricht ended May 2015, charges include:

• Drug trafficing

• Money laundering

• Conspiracy to commit murder

• IT Security breaching

• Tax evasion

• ...

• In conclusion: don’t use your own email for everything illegal that

involves millions of dollars...

• Ross Ulbricht is sentenced to life imprisonment without parole.
